Empowering Malaysia’s Youths: REGENERASI Launches #MYPalmPride Campaign
Published:  Mar 28, 2024 10:17 AM
Updated: 2:17 AM

Malaysia, March 28, 2024 - REGENERASI, a leading NGO dedicated to educating and empowering Malaysian youths in the realms of regeneration, sustainability, and food security, proudly announces the launch of its ground-breaking campaign, #MYPalmPride. With a mission to dispel misconceptions surrounding palm oil production and promote its sustainability, this initiative is poised to make waves nationwide.

Kicked off on 1 March 2024, and extending to August 31, 2024, #MYPalmPride represents a collective effort driven by the passionate Youth Council of REGENERASI, led by its Leader, Hoh Jia Da under the steadfast guidance of its President, Datin Emilia Uzir. 

In Malaysia, where misperceptions about palm oil's impact on the environment persist, particularly among the younger generation, #MYPalmPride aims to set the record straight. By focusing on education and awareness, the campaign seeks to enlighten Malaysian youths about the sustainable and responsible practices involved in Malaysian palm oil production, highlighting its positive contributions to both the economy and the environment.
